Chase Robinson and Jay Greeson preview the 2025 college football season for the LSU Tigers. Topics Include: LSU brings in the top transfer class in the country. Garrett Nussmeier returns after throwing for over 4,000 yards a season ago, and they have upgraded the receiver room around him. Harold Perkins returns on defense after his injury last season, and they have also added pieces around him to add depth to this defense.

On June 6th, Judge Claudia Wilken approved a deal between the NCAA, its most powerful conferences, and lawyers representing all Division I athletes. Paving the way for schools to pay players directly for the first time. This landmark moment seems poised to change the landscape of college athletics, especially NCAA football. Rece Davis and Pete Thamel breakdown what we know right now, what the hurdles in the road could be, and discuss whether or not coaches and administrators will be able to follow the rules, now that the rules are clear.
